Is operations manager a high position?

An operations manager is typically considered a mid- to senior-level position responsible for overseeing daily business activities, managing teams, and improving efficiency. It is generally regarded as a leadership role with significant responsibilities, often requiring experience and relevant certifications. The position's seniority can vary depending on the company's size and structure.

What other jobs can an operations manager do?

An operations manager can transition into roles such as project manager, supply chain manager, or business analyst, leveraging skills in process improvement, leadership, and resource management. They may also move into executive positions like director of operations or COO, often requiring experience in strategic planning and organizational oversight.

Job description

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ES (All or some of these duties will be performed)

  • Warranty and Finance contract closings
  • Responsible for evaluating initial sales agreements against final finance documents
  • Uses discretion to create final sales agreements to coincide with the finance documents
  • During closings with customers, authority to make changes to sales agreements if there are issues at the closing table and then reprint and close customers with revised documents
  • As part of the funding process, gather additional lender required items at their discretion in order to accomplish the funding of the deal for PHV
  • Project Coordination with contractors, project costing
  • Responsible for gathering bids through project completion.
  • Has discretion to identify best vendor for each individual project
  • Has discretion to switch vendors if not satisfied with work quality or progress
  • Has authority to alter scheduling of vendor work based on changes in customer or company priorities
  • Responsible for holding vendors accountable to written work estimates if there are discrepancies
  • Routinely search for recommended new vendors or for the elimination of poor quality vendors
  • Routinely provide management with evaluation reports of both internal and external customers and made recommendations on process improvements
  • Customer Service Scheduling
  • Full autonomy to arrange, modify and authorize service via factories or vendors for the sole purpose of customer satisfaction and contract completion
  • Has authority to alter schedule or scope of work for the above
  • Responsible for direct communication with dissatisfied customers and negotiations with them as to solutions.  Escalate issues to upper management if cost is substantial or needs advice on how to communicate on a specific situation
  • Make recommendations to management based on the facts when needing to reply to a customer or to a government body for conflict resolution
  • Data base management
  • Allowed to, at their discretion, update deal tracking and deal status reports based on their own assessment of the deal
  • On their own judgement allowed to use company applications to update information missing from deals as seen fit
  • Commission calculations
  • Responsible for the proper review of costing for the payment of commissions.  Has authority for the entry of key information utilized for paying commissions

MINIMUM QUALIFICIATIONS

  • High School Diploma
  • 2 year Degree preferred
  • Willing to Travel up to 50% locally and during normal business hours
